San Francisco, CA – $75,000–$82,000.00
Overview We are seeking a talented Technical Designer with a strong focus on fit and garment engineering to join our team. The ideal candidate will have a robust understanding of patternmaking and garment construction, particularly for petite sizes, and will drive the fit and quality of our products. This role requires collaboration with cross-functional teams to ensure our garments meet the highest standards of quality and fit, enhancing customer satisfaction.
Key Responsibilities
Lead the creation and evolution of foundational patterns to maintain a consistent fit across product categories.
Manage and update technical packages throughout the production process, ensuring clear communication of fit specifications to vendors.
Facilitate regular fit sessions to refine product dimensions, focusing on product types such as denim and other bottom wear.
Analyze sales data to identify top-performing and underperforming styles, using insights to drive fit enhancements.
Maintain product timelines and ensure timely approvals to align with production schedules.
Collaborate on the development and implementation of technical tools to support fit processes and innovation.
Work closely with vendors to manage fit assessments and implement adjustments as necessary.
Engage with design and product teams to optimize style and fit, ensuring a balance of comfort and aesthetics.
Conduct wear tests and leverage insights to support continuous product improvement.
Qualifications
Bachelor’s degree in Fashion Design, Technical Design, or related field, or equivalent experience.
Over 8 years in women’s technical design, with significant experience in patternmaking and garment fitting.
Deep knowledge of petite sizing, fit, and garment construction, with an emphasis on denim is a plus.
Proficiency in 2D pattern software, along with tools like Adobe Illustrator and productivity suites.
Experience in resolving production challenges in collaboration with factories, both domestic and overseas.
Proven ability to develop fit from inception and adapt across multiple garment styles.
